Experimental Display Referenced Flight Control System with Automatic Takeoff Rotation and Climbout.

Abstract

The report describes a pilot-in-the-loop Display Referenced Flight Control System for automatic longitudinal control of an aircraft during takeoff ground roll, rotation, and climbout. The takeoff control system configuration uses the Display Referenced Flight Control System described in AFFDL TR-71-90, a KC-135 as the test aircraft, and the KC-135 rotate/go-around system described in Air Force T. O. 1C-135(K)A-2-11 as the longitudinal steering signal source. The integration of the rotate/go-around steering signal into the Display Referenced Flight Control System to satisfy the KC-135 aircraft takeoff dynamics is presented. Also the technique of providing a pilot-in-the-loop capability through pilot control force steering during the takeoff maneuver is discussed. (Author)
